JVL A/S - User Manual - Integrated Servo Motors MAC050 - 4500 255
5.7 Expansion Module MAC00-FD4
5.7.12 Instance 2, Attribute 3, Motor status
With this object, the status of the motor can be monitored.
Bit 7: Unused - reserved for future purposes.
Bit 6: Equals 1, if the velocity is decreasing.
Bit 5: Equals 1, if the velocity is increasing.
Bit 4: Equals 1, if the motor is in the commanded position.
Bit 3: Unused - reserved for future purposes.
Bit 2: Equals 1, if a limit switch has been activated.
Bit 1: Equals 1, if there is a communication error between the MAC00-FDx and the
motor. This can occur if the motor was reset due to a voltage drop.
Bit 0: Equals 1, if there is a fatal motor error. Read subindex 4 for extended informa-
tion.
5.7.13 Instance 3, Attribute 3, Module setup bits
This object is used for auxiliary setup of the module.
Endless relative: When this bit is 1, the endless relative position mode is used for incre-
mental positioning. When using this mode, absolute positioning can no longer be used.
Error action: Determines the action in the event of an error. Bit6 set to 0 will set the mo-
tor in passive mode in case of an error, Bit6 set to 1 will stop motor by setting velocity
to 0 in the event of an error.
5.7.14 Instance 3, Attribute 4, FastMac command
When writing to this attribute, a FastMac command is executed. Please refer to the
MAC00-FPx section for a description of the FastMac commands.
5.7.15 Instance 3, Attribute 5, Module command
When writing to this attribute, it is possible to execute some special commands on the
MAC00-FDx module.
The following commands are available:
Bit 7 6 5 4 3 2 1 0
Data -
Decele-
ration
Accele-
ration
In
position
-
Limit
switch
error
Discon-
nected
Motor
error
Bit 7 6 5 4 3 2 1 0
Setup
Endless
relative
Error
action
Reserved
Number Function
0 No operation
1 Reset limit error
2 Reset communication error
3-255 Reserved